Linglong Lays Foundation Stone for Fourth Domestic Manufacturing Base
On July 6, 2018, on the occasion of the second anniversary of Linglong Tire listing, the foundation stone laying ceremony of Hubei Linglong Tire, the fourth domestic manufacturing base of Linglong in China, as well as 2018 Linglong Tire global partners conference was successfully held in Jingmen, Hubei Province in China. Nearly 1,000 Linglong’s global partners gathered in Jingmen to witness this great moment of Linglong Tire and took this opportunity to seek further deepening strategic cooperation with Linglong. The related leaders from Chinese petrochemical industry and rubber industry as well as media friends also attended the ceremony to express their best wishes to Linglong Tire.

At the beginning of Chinese 12th five-year plan (from 2011 to 2015), Linglong put forward “3+3” global industrial layout strategy. Within five years, the company has built three domestic manufacturing bases in Zhaoyuan, Dezhou and Liuzhou and its first overseas manufacturing base in Thailand, which could improve Linglong’s global competitiveness comprehensively. In 2017, taking the actual situations into consideration, Linglong adjusted its “3+3” strategy into “5+3”, and intended to build the fourth manufacturing base in Jingmen, which could lay a solid foundation for improving Linglong’s international market competitiveness to a great degree.
Hubei Linglong Tire will cover an area of over 900,000 square meters with planned floor area more than 700,000 square meters. The main products of this manufacturing base will include TBR tire, PCR tire, and OTR etc., with the aim of annual capacity of PCR reaching 12 million units, annual capacity of TBR reaching 2.4 million units, and the annual capacity of OTR reaching 60,000 units. The sales revenue of Hubei Linglong is estimated to reach RMB five billion when this base is built. It is worth pointing out that this manufacturing base will integrate intelligent manufacturing, PLM (product lifecycle management), industrial big data application, high-end brand. This presents another important measure for company to break through regional restriction, focusing on resource integrity, fostering core competitiveness, and it is of great significance for the company to serve customers at zero distance, improve market share and reduce logistics cost.
Linglong Tire will continue take interdisciplinary talent as foundation, innovation as core, premium brand as assistant, high quality sale as kinetic energy, continue to promote the 5 + 3 global industry layout to achieve the strategic goal of developing into a world-class tire enterprise as soon as possible.
